Biography

Fidelis Adewole is the Managing Partner at G. Elias. He holds a Bachelor of Laws degree from Ambrose Alli University, Ekpoma where he graduated top of his class. He won two awards at the Nigerian Law School: Prince Bola Ajibola’s prize for being the most proficient student in Civil Procedure Paper; and Dr. Mudiaga Odje’s prize for being the most proficient student in Civil Procedure and Criminal Procedure Papers.

Fidelis is a Fellow of the Chartered Institute of Arbitrators (UK) and the Chartered Institute of Taxation of Nigeria. He is also an Associate of Chartered Institute of Stockbrokers. He is a Notary Public.
